Output 8d0f2671c21f3a94391d08fea001b2dd65f013e8c28709f04d075d632d1b3619:1

value
258531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dabe31bc1431be85ed93cd328aff88b22a4a8d5e OP_EQUAL
address
3Mdd5Hw77rrw6MWqP3XPAXXGQkmvV9DfmW
transaction
8d0f2671c21f3a94391d08fea001b2dd65f013e8c28709f04d075d632d1b3619
spent
true